Comment sauvegarder ou migrer les données d'un affilié ?

La sauvegarde ou la migration de vos données d'affiliation est une étape essentielle lorsque vous transférez votre site Web vers un nouveau serveur, que vous effectuez des mises à jour importantes ou que vous protégez simplement vos informations. Dans ce guide, nous aborderons les meilleures pratiques et les outils permettant de sauvegarder et de migrer les données d'affiliation en toute sécurité.

Méthodes de sauvegarde ou de migration des données des affiliés

Exporter et importer votre base de données MySQL

La méthode la plus directe pour sauvegarder ou migrer des données d'affiliation est de passer par votre base de données MySQL. Des outils comme phpMyAdmin vous permettent d'exporter et d'importer facilement votre base de données. Suivez les étapes décrites dans le guide Moving WordPress de WordPress.org pour des instructions détaillées.

Traitement des données des campagnes lors de l'exportation

Lorsque vous effectuez un vidage MySQL, vous pouvez rencontrer l'erreur suivante :
#1227 - Access denied; you need (at least one of) the SUPER privilege(s) for this operation

Cette erreur est causée par le wp_affiliate_wp_campaigns qui est en fait un tableau vue plutôt qu'un tableau standard. Pour résoudre ce problème :

  • Exclure le wp_affiliate_wp_campaigns de votre exportation.
  • La vue des campagnes est automatiquement générée à partir de la vue referrals et visits L'exclusion de cette table n'aura donc pas d'incidence sur l'intégrité des données.

Utilisation des plugins de sauvegarde et de migration de WordPress

Pour une approche plus conviviale, envisagez d'utiliser l'un des plugins suivants pour sauvegarder ou migrer vos données d'affiliation et autres informations de site :

  • Duplicator: Un plugin puissant qui crée une copie complète de votre site WordPress, y compris les données AffiliateWP, à des fins de migration ou de sauvegarde.
  • WP Migrate DB: particulièrement utile pour migrer des bases de données avec des fonctionnalités de recherche et de remplacement.

Bonnes pratiques pour les sauvegardes et les migrations

  • Veillez à sauvegarder régulièrement vos données d'affiliation afin d'éviter toute perte de données lors des mises à jour ou des migrations.
  • Avant d'entamer une migration, testez la sauvegarde pour vous assurer que toutes les données nécessaires, y compris les informations sur les affiliés, ont été capturées correctement.
  • N'oubliez pas d'exclure le wp_affiliate_wp_campaigns pendant l'exportation si vous rencontrez des erreurs. Cela n'affectera pas les données de votre campagne puisqu'elles sont créées dynamiquement à partir du fichier referrals et visits tables.
  • Optez pour des plugins bien supportés comme Duplicator pour rationaliser le processus. Ces plugins gèrent souvent des problèmes courants tels que les données sérialisées, ce qui garantit une migration transparente.

Voilà, c'est fait ! La sauvegarde et la migration des données d'affiliation sont simples avec des outils comme phpMyAdmin ou des plugins comme Duplicator. En suivant les meilleures pratiques et en vous assurant de prendre en compte les nuances spécifiques à la base de données, comme la vue des campagnes, vous pouvez protéger votre programme d'affiliation lors de toute modification de l'infrastructure de votre site Web.